Thompson Photo Works purchased several new, highly sophisticated processing machines. The production department needed some guidance with respect to qualifications needed by an operator. Is age a factor? Is the length of service as an operator (in years) important? In order to explore further the factors needed to estimate performance on the new processing machines, four variables were listed: X1 = Length of time an employee was in the industry. X2 = Mechanical aptitude test score. X3 = Prior on-the-job rating. X4 = Age. Performance on the new machine is designated Y. Thirty employees were selected at random. Data were collected for each, and their performances on the new machines were recorded. A few results are: Name Performance on New Machine, Y Length of Time in Industry, X1 Mechanical Aptitude Score, X2 Prior On-the-Job Performance X3 Age, X4 Mike Miraglia 112 12 312 121 52 Sue Trythall 113 2 380 123 27 The equation is: = 11.6 + 0.4X1 + 0.286X2 + 0.112X3 + 0.002X4 (a) What is this equation called? (e) Carl Knox applied for a job at Photo Works. He has been in the business for six years, and scored 280 on the mechanical aptitude test. Carl’s prior on-the-job performance rating is 97, and he is 35 years old. Estimate Carl’s performance on the new machine. (Round your answer to 3 decimal places.)
Explanation / Answer
A) As it is the estiamted relation between dependent and independent variables, so it is called Multiple regression equation.
B) there are one dependent variables and four independent variables.
C) As 0.286 is the coefficient of X2 so it is called Regression Coefficient.
D) As Age increases by one year then estimated performance of the machine increases by coefficient of age(X4) in the regression equation, i,e 0.002 unit(ans)
E) Performance on new machine = 11.6 + 0.4 *6 + 0.286*280+ 0.112*97+0.002*35 = 105.014 (ans)
